An Interview with Juan Pastor Millet %A Ma Yolanda Fern芍ndez-Su芍rez %J Estudios Irlandeses : Journal of Irish Studies %D 2011 %I Asociaci車n Espa?ola de Estudios Irlandeses %X Juan Pastor Millet was born in Alicante in 1943. He has a degree in Drama and did his training with William Layton and Arnold Taraborrelli in Laboratorio T.E.I.Till 1980 he worked as a theatre, cinema and TV actor. As an independent director he has produced plays by both Spanish and foreign contemporary authors, and also by classic ones like Calder車n de la Barca, Shakespeare, Cervantes, Moli豕re, Ibsen, Strindberg and Brecht. From 1987 till 2006 he combined his job as a director with his job as a Drama teacher at RESAD (Real Escuela Superior de Arte Dram芍tico). In November 2003 he opened his own Studio and Theatre House in Madrid 每 Guindalera. From then on he devotes all his time to the family project Guindalera Escena Abierta together with his wife Teresa Valent赤n-Gamazo and their daughter, the actress Mar赤a Pastor. In 2009 while they were celebrating Brian Friel*s 80th anniversary staging three of his plays 每 El Juego de Yalta, Molly Sweeney and Bailando en Lughnasa 每 they were awarded the prestigious ※Premio Ojo Cr赤tico de Teatro§ for their commitment to new authors and their pedagogical character. %K Brian Friel %K Juan Pastor %K Teatro Guindalera %K El Juego de Yalta %K Molly Sweeney %K Bailando en Lughnasa %K Theatre %K ※Premio Ojo Cr赤tico de Teatro§ %U http://www.estudiosirlandeses.org/Issue6/PDFsIssue6/Mˋa_Yolanda_%20Fernˋˋndez_Suˋˋrez.pdf
